You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@camel.apache.org by da...@apache.org on 2010/10/21 19:51:00 UTC

svn commit: r1026081 - in /camel/trunk: components/camel-hawtdb/src/test/java/org/apache/camel/component/hawtdb/HawtDBGrowIssueTest.java parent/pom.xml

Author: davsclaus
Date: Thu Oct 21 17:51:00 2010
New Revision: 1026081

URL: http://svn.apache.org/viewvc?rev=1026081&view=rev
Log:
CAMEL-3249: Upgraded hawtdb with has an important bug fix.

Modified:
    camel/trunk/components/camel-hawtdb/src/test/java/org/apache/camel/component/hawtdb/HawtDBGrowIssueTest.java
    camel/trunk/parent/pom.xml

Modified: camel/trunk/components/camel-hawtdb/src/test/java/org/apache/camel/component/hawtdb/HawtDBGrowIssueTest.java
URL: http://svn.apache.org/viewvc/camel/trunk/components/camel-hawtdb/src/test/java/org/apache/camel/component/hawtdb/HawtDBGrowIssueTest.java?rev=1026081&r1=1026080&r2=1026081&view=diff
==============================================================================
--- camel/trunk/components/camel-hawtdb/src/test/java/org/apache/camel/component/hawtdb/HawtDBGrowIssueTest.java (original)
+++ camel/trunk/components/camel-hawtdb/src/test/java/org/apache/camel/component/hawtdb/HawtDBGrowIssueTest.java Thu Oct 21 17:51:00 2010
@@ -22,13 +22,11 @@ import org.apache.camel.test.junit4.Came
 import org.fusesource.hawtbuf.Buffer;
 import org.fusesource.hawtdb.api.SortedIndex;
 import org.fusesource.hawtdb.api.Transaction;
-import org.junit.Ignore;
 import org.junit.Test;
 
 /**
  * @version $Revision$
  */
-@Ignore("See CAMEL-3249")
 public class HawtDBGrowIssueTest extends CamelTestSupport {
 
     private HawtDBCamelCodec codec = new HawtDBCamelCodec();
@@ -70,7 +68,7 @@ public class HawtDBGrowIssueTest extends
         for (int i = 0; i < size; i++) {
             final Buffer data = codec.marshallKey(i + "-" + sb.toString());
 
-            System.out.println("Updating " + i);
+            log.debug("Updating " + i);
 
             hawtDBFile.execute(new Work<Object>() {
                 public Object execute(Transaction tx) {
@@ -89,7 +87,9 @@ public class HawtDBGrowIssueTest extends
         });
 
         String data = codec.unmarshallKey(out);
-        System.out.println(data);
+        log.info(data);
+        assertTrue("Should be 1023", data.startsWith("1023"));
+        assertEquals(1029, data.length());
     }
 
 }

Modified: camel/trunk/parent/pom.xml
URL: http://svn.apache.org/viewvc/camel/trunk/parent/pom.xml?rev=1026081&r1=1026080&r2=1026081&view=diff
==============================================================================
--- camel/trunk/parent/pom.xml (original)
+++ camel/trunk/parent/pom.xml Thu Oct 21 17:51:00 2010
@@ -72,7 +72,7 @@
     <guiceyfruit-version>2.0</guiceyfruit-version>
     <hamcrest-version>1.2-dev1</hamcrest-version>
     <hawtbuf-version>1.2</hawtbuf-version>
-    <hawtdb-version>1.4</hawtdb-version>
+    <hawtdb-version>1.5</hawtdb-version>
     <hibernate-version>3.2.6.ga</hibernate-version>
     <hibernate-entitymanager-version>3.2.1.ga</hibernate-entitymanager-version>
     <hsqldb-version>1.8.0.7</hsqldb-version>